Whitehall outlines graduation programs, concerts and student celebrations

Summary

District staff reviewed draft commencement and promotion programs, confirmed the commencement speaker and praised recent student events including a talent show and middle-school concert. Staff emphasized drafts will be finalized before weekend ceremonies.

Presenter reviewed draft programs for upcoming graduation and promotion ceremonies and said staff will update drafts before Sunday’s commencement.

"These were put together by... mister Silvani, his journey, missus Osterholm," Presenter said while noting the documents are drafts. Presenter also noted the middle-school concert was under way and praised student participation. On the talent show, Presenter said it was an in-house event without broad advertising: "It was in house. It was a school event. Cell phones were not committed, and it was awesome." The presenter thanked student council and staff for organizing and said the ceremonies reflect substantial staff effort.

Why it matters: program details affect families, guests and logistics for weekend events. Staff asked the board to review draft programs and return any corrections promptly; no formal board action was required on these drafts at the meeting.
